Mićo Mićić ( Serbian - Cyrillic Мићо Мићић ; born September 6, 1956 in Bijeljina , Yugoslavia ; † December 23, 2020 in Banja Luka , Bosnia and Herzegovina ) was a Bosnian politician ( Srpska Demokratska Stranka , from March 2020: Stranka demokratske ) .

Life

Mićić graduated from the University of Sarajevo with a degree in sports science in 1981 and then worked as a sports teacher at schools in Kalesija and Bijeljina until 1996 . Afterwards he was head of the war disabled department in the city administration of Bijeljina.

In the Republika Srpska he was Minister for Refugees and Displaced Persons in the government of Mladen Ivanić from 2001 , then from 2004 to 2005 Minister for Labor and War Disabled in the government of Dragan Mikerević . After a brief stint as Director of the Pension Insurance of the Republika Srpska, he was elected Mayor of Bijeljina in 2005 and then re-elected several times, most recently in 2016.

In March 2020, Mićić was expelled from the SDS; according to his own statements, because he put the interests of the city above the interests of the party. He then founded the Stranka demokratske Srpske Semberija party and became its chairman. In the mayoral election on November 15, 2020, Mićić lost to Ljubiša Petrović , the SDS candidate.

On November 26, 2020, Mićić was tested positive for SARS-CoV-2 and brought to the University Hospital of Banja Luka, where he was connected to a ventilator from December 2, 2020 . He died there three weeks later.
